Liard River Hot Springs Replacement Facility

Liard River, BC

The Liard River Hot Springs project replaces the existing timber deck and change room facility that was eroding due to environmental exposure. Overall, the replacement design addresses the needs of the rugged northern climate while creating a welcoming environment for the hot spring bathers.

Awards

2014 Canadian Wood Council Award, Use of Red Cedar

Client

Ministry of the Environment, Province of British Columbia

Year Completed

2012

Size

310 

m2
 / 3337 ft2

Formline Team

Alfred Waugh, Matthew Lahey, Nick Bray

Consultants

Structural Engineer: Equilibrium Consulting
